For example reduced representation experiments (230 genes; 2-4 wells) (~150,000 cells) we are able to normalize single cells in a single file using standard approaches. Two important notes:

  • this approach will not adjust for technical artifacts induced by site and well
  • this approach will not scale particularly easily to the millions of cells in whole genome experiments

We need to find a solution to normalize single cells within each site. This will also likely help us a bunch in our gene- and guide-level aggregated perturbation profiles.
